Examples
-
2 calorie (th)/second equals 8.368 × 10^18 attojoule/second [aJ/s]
-
0.5 calorie (th)/second equals 2.092 × 10^18 attojoule/second [aJ/s]

Frequently Asked Questions
-
What does 1 calorie (th)/second represent?
-
It represents the power of transferring one thermochemical calorie of energy per second, exactly equal to 4.184 watts.
-
When would I use attojoule per second as a unit?
-
Attojoule per second is used for extremely small power levels, such as leakage power in ultra-low-power microelectronics or energy transfer in quantum devices.

Key Terminology
-
Calorie (th)/second
-
A power unit representing the transfer of one thermochemical calorie per second, equal to 4.184 watts, commonly used in calorimetry and older thermal power contexts.
-
Attojoule/second [aJ/s]
-
A unit of power denoting 10^-18 joules transferred per second, used to quantify extremely low power rates in nanoscale and quantum devices.
-
Thermochemical calorie
-
A calorie defined precisely as 4.184 joules, used in defining the calorie (th)/second power unit.
